My Refrigerator Has A Code Of 59 And Ef On The Display Panel?

My refridgerator has a code of 59 and EF on the sidplay panels. What does this mean?

Good Morning Strollinghills,

I understand that you are receiving a code of “SY EF” on your Electrolux refrigerator, model# EW28BS71I. This code says that there a system error, possibly with the Evaporator Fan. This can also be a false error code. I suggest resetting your appliance, by either unplugging it or shutting the power off at the circuit breaker, for 3-5 minutes. Restore power and press the “alarm off” button to stop the beeping.
